Imagina a Laura, gerente de operaciones de una mediana empresa de logística en Lima. Lleva meses usando un software genérico que no se adapta a sus procesos de gestión de flotas. Cada semana, su equipo pierde horas forzando el sistema a hacer tareas que no fueron diseñadas para ellas. Una tarde, mientras exporta datos a Excel, se pregunta: "¿Realmente existe una forma de tener un sistema que haga exactamente lo que necesito?". Esa frustración la lleva a investigar sobre custom development services o servicios de desarrollo personalizado. Todo suena bien en teoría, pero surgen preguntas inmediatas: ¿cuánto cuesta? ¿cuánto tiempo toma? ¿y si el resultado no es lo que espero? Aquí respondemos las preguntas más frecuentes basadas en experiencias reales de negocios como el de Laura.
¿Qué son exactamente los servicios de desarrollo personalizado y en qué se diferencian del software estándar?
Los servicios de desarrollo personalizado, o custom development services, consisten en crear una solución de software desde cero (o adaptando un framework existente) para cumplir con requisitos específicos de un negocio. A diferencia de los productos comerciales listos para usar —como un CRM genérico o un ERP—, el desarrollo a medida se construye pensando en los procesos únicos que hacen funcionar tu empresa. Por ejemplo, si necesitas integrar un sistema de inventario con un flujo de aprobación de compras propio de tu organización, un software estándar rara vez lo permite sin módulos separados. Los sistemas personalizados ofrecen ventajas claras: mayor control sobre funcionalidades, escalabilidad, integración con herramientas existentes y propiedad total del código. Programa Financiero Simple es un ejemplo de cómo soluciones desarrolladas a medida pueden resolver necesidades específicas sin rodeos. Sin embargo, antes de empezar, es vital entender que no es una compra inmediata, sino un proceso colaborativo entre tú y el equipo de desarrollo. Muchos negocios cometen el error de pensar que personalizado es sinónimo de "copiar y pegar otro sistema con otro color". En realidad, implica un análisis profundo de funciones que lo harán realmente útil.
¿Cuánto cuesta desarrollar un software personalizado? Desglose realista de costos
Una de las preguntas que detiene a la mayoría de empresarios es: "¿qué precio tiene todo esto?". No existe una cifra exacta porque el costo depende de la complejidad, las funcionalidades requeridas, la tecnología elegida y la experiencia del proveedor. En promedio, las tarifas para equipos de desarrollo personalizado rondan entre 60 y 150 dólares por hora en Latinoamérica. Un proyecto sencillo como una aplicación móvil con tres o cuatro pantallas puede arrancar en 5,000–8,000 USD. Algo más pesado, como un sistema de gestión empresarial con módulos de clientes, facturación, compras e informes automatizados, podría fácilmente situarse entre 25,000 y 60,000 USD. Los entregables que más influyen son: diseño UX/UI personalizado, armado de bases de datos, arquitectura segura, integración de APIs externas, pruebas, documentación y despliegue. También suma el mantenimiento poslanzamiento: tradicionalmente un 15–20% del costo inicial anual. Para tener claridad, solicita al proveedor una cotización detallada por módulo. En la práctica, los negocios que destinan un equipo de revisión interna reducen sobrecostos porque evitan que se introduzcan funciones innecesarias. A la hora de proyectar el ROI, consulta al desarrollador dos casos hipotéticos de desviación de alcance. Así no te afectará una mala gestión. Un buen partner financiero será transparente sobre elasticidad de costos. Tan importante como el costo es verificar experiencia en tu industria. Definir un límite de gasto mensual después del lanzamiento puede hacerse mediante Consulting Services Financial para mantener las finanzas en orden.
¿Cuánto tiempo tarda un proyecto de desarrollo y cómo funciona el proceso?
El tiempo de entrega es otra variable frecuente. Algo simple como un portal de clientes con login, perfil y tres formularios puede gestionarse en cuatro a seis semanas. Un sistema mayor, como una plataforma de e-learning corporativo con usuarios, roles y generación automática de certificados, puede durar de tres a seis meses. Esto rompe con el ideal de muchos emprendedores que esperan que cualquier proyecto esté listo en dos semanas. Las etapas típicas a cumplir son: (1) relevamiento y análisis de requerimientos (2–4 semanas), donde tú y el equipo especifican qué debe hacer el sistema; aquí se genera el compendio funcional. Luego (2) diseño y prototipado no interactivo (1–2 semanas) para alinear visualmente en pantalla o en mockups. La tercera es (3) implementación full y test unitarios, que toma el 50% del cronograma total. Posteriormente (4) pruebas con usuario, integración y deployment para confirmar que la calidad es aceptable en producción, y (5) publicación y formación al personal clave. Un error recurrente: delegar la revisión. Es buena práctica dedicar un encargado de negocio con poder para aprobar tareas dejando trazabilidad. Recomiéndales incorporar una lista de logros (ever-given) semanal con pendientes asignados y fechas feas. Las soluciones custom development good presentan un planning de riesgos compartido. Así sabrás que nada está en baloncesto informático. Acceder a una línea de métrica social mediante Consulting Services Financial es sensato si el negocio apenas comienza hacer dev soportable— renglón menor provecho decide fusionar la paorta sin pestañear.
¿Y si el resultado no es lo que espero? Gestión de cambios y aseguramiento de calidad
Hay miedo real a invertir tiempo y dinero y recibir un sistema que no sirve. Los teams implementan metodologías ágiles como Scrum o versiones de contorno con sprints de 2 semanas. En cada sprint se muestran trozos funcionales. Así reduces grandes sorpresas porque creces con retro insitu. A la altura del iter dos estás viendo datos dinámicos y observando lagunas. En el contexto "UAT" – User Acceptance Testing – recibes acreditación en la funcionalidad real completa. También integraciones seguras cobran un rol central. Cuando mencionaste una dependencia externa, como conectores con bancos o ERP, debes validar una interficie trabajable temprana (por semana uno se sabe problemas, no al último día). La clave: QA mínimo dos veces: unidad primero desarrollador; después tester profesional más usuario reáis senior. Puedan detectar objetos visibles opacos y sor microflujos. Los riesgos ocultos es viajar — elegir al que banca waterfall- tó con reglas móviles — nos ahogó más plata que engancha bugs post release. Por garantía ofrecen mantenimiento contra errores hasta por tres meses - porque los mapas code sean curvidos. Recordá que Programa Financiero Simple está preparado a un resuelto evitativo bajo costos fletes indemnizados. Nunca omitas check list: comprobar read dev seed repos y ramificar y git proof point resguardos ramales.
¿Qué buscar al contratar a un agente de custom development services y cuándo es momento de no hacerlo?
Expertos coinciden: select the dev house que responde offline in words técnicas y presta signos lean ones. Idónea charla exige sobre valores mínimos diferentes. Ve por pedazos si existen muestras con ideas pre- elegidas tecnologías claras – no plataforma caprichod - En una urgencia “me venden genialidad muda”, es riesgo. Cinéate cúantic valor desarrollo normal. Laccionarios avíscives : prototipaje early secuabilidad caso analizadas anterior. Casos menos complejizados convocar un taller entre stakeholders no adivinen macro— pregunta, retabas y atinanzas software el.
- Costeo visible (unitario o T&M seguro pagos hitzeitos). Sin riffs facturados no noten break point sobreacuestro pactual lo redimen inversiones sí.
- Responsiveness garantizadas QAx2 & reworking bajo SLA: weekly demo commitment”. VAA’ recission correct firmas contratual covers custom dev quality segling guiões fix daily patches bi-chats test.
- Complement de pátina lecal y portada legal (code disclaimer IP write sin waiting) compart ramos que es natural.